Method for preparation of three-dimensional ordered macroporous Ce-Zr material by using PMMA as template
A three-dimensional ordered, ce-zr technology, applied in the field of material chemistry, can solve the problems of poor thermal stability, small specific surface area, and no special structure, etc., to achieve excellent heat dissipation performance, large specific surface area, improved catalytic activity and production efficiency rate effect

[0026] Example 1
[0027] (1) According to the molar ratio of Ce ion to Zr ion of 3:1, mix cerium nitrate and zirconium nitrate, and then add deionized water to prepare a solution with a concentration of 0.1 mol / L;
[0028] (2) According to the mass ratio of metal salt (cerium nitrate and zirconium nitrate):citric acid = 1:1.5, add citric acid to the solution of step (1), and stir at a constant temperature of 40 at a speed of 800r / min at 30°C. minute;
[0029] (3) According to the mass ratio of PMMA: metal salt (cerium nitrate and zirconium nitrate)=1:1, add the PMMA template to the solution of step (2) for mixing;
[0030] (4) Put the mixed solution of step (3) to stand at room temperature for 3 hours, and then place it at 90°C for 24 hours to dry at a constant temperature to obtain a crude product to remove the water;
[0031] (5) The crude product obtained in step (4) is heated to 500°C at a heating rate of 2°C / min and kept at constant temperature for 3 hours to obtain a three-dimen...

[0036] Example 2
[0037] (1) According to the molar ratio of Ce ion to Zr ion of 9:1, mix cerium nitrate and zirconium nitrate, and then add deionized water to prepare a solution with a concentration of 0.5 mol / L;
[0038] (2) According to the mass ratio of metal salt (cerium nitrate and zirconium nitrate):citric acid = 1:1.2, add citric acid to the solution of step (1), and stir at a constant temperature of 1000r / min at 20°C for 30 minute;
[0039] (3) According to the mass ratio of PMMA:metal salt (cerium nitrate and zirconium nitrate) = 1:2, add the PMMA template to the solution of step (2) for mixing;
[0040] (4) The mixed solution of step (3) is allowed to stand at room temperature for 4 hours, and then dried at 60°C for 20 hours to obtain a crude product to remove moisture;
[0041] (5) The crude product obtained in step (4) is heated to 450°C at a heating rate of 2°C / min and kept at a constant temperature for 4 hours to obtain a three-dimensional ordered macroporous Ce-Zr mate...

[0046] Example 3
[0047] (1) According to the molar ratio of Ce ion to Zr ion of 1:1, mix cerium nitrate and zirconium nitrate, and then add deionized water to obtain a solution with a concentration of 1mol / L;
[0048] (2) According to the mass ratio of metal salt (cerium nitrate and zirconium nitrate):citric acid=1:1, add citric acid to the solution of step (1), and stir at a constant temperature of 300r / min at 90℃ for 60 minute;
[0049] (3) According to the mass ratio of PMMA: metal salt (cerium nitrate and zirconium nitrate) = 1:3, add the PMMA template to the solution of step (2) for mixing;
[0050] (4) The mixed solution of step (3) is allowed to stand at room temperature for 2 hours, and then dried at 30°C for 12 to 24 hours to obtain a crude product to remove the water;
[0051] (5) The crude product obtained in step (4) is heated to 600°C at a heating rate of 2°C / min and kept at constant temperature for 2 hours to obtain a three-dimensional ordered macroporous Ce-Zr material...
